Keyhan Farian, Nyack Physician, Dies at 80

Dr. Keyhan Farian, an 80 year old resident of  Nyack, was struck by a car and killed while walking on North Broadway on Tuesday. The Journal News reports that Dr. Farian, born and raised in Iran, dedicated 40 years of her medical career working with families at Lincoln Hospital in the South Bronx. She had lived in Nyack for 33 years.

Clarkstown Police have charged Mahmoud Ibrahim of Valley Cottage with permitting unlicensed operation of a motor vehicle for allowing his 16-year old daughter to drive with a learner’s permit without a licensed driver in the car.

Dr. Farian’s son, Richard Anderson, told the Journal News the situation was “tragic all around.”

Source: Journal News, 1/20/2010
